On 21-11 15:39, Victor Palacio wrote:
> I've been reading that recently that SER does not yet have any support 
> for a PAM module.

  No, there is no support for PAM.

> Since their aren't any PAM modules, can SER send plain-text passwords 
> to a Radius server? That way we can use PAM on our Radius server to 
> authenticate and lookup accounts on servers running  Kerberos and LDAP?

  No. SIP uses digest authentication, that means ser receives digest
  credentials and sends them to radius server for verification. The
  radius server returns Valid/Invalid.

> Or does SER forward credentials (digested or hashed) that it receives 
> from a sip-client (say from a Cisco 7960)?

  Yes.
